Company Overview

overview logo History and Background

Fabrinet was founded in 2000 by David T. Mitchell. It specializes in providing precision optical, electro-mechanical, and electronic manufacturing services to original equipment manufacturers (OEMs). The company initially focused on optical communications but has expanded into other markets like industrial lasers, automotive, and medical devices.

business area logo Core Business Areas

  • Optical Communications: Manufactures complex optical components and modules for telecom and datacom applications.
  • Industrial Lasers: Provides manufacturing services for lasers used in materials processing, medical applications, and scientific research.
  • Automotive: Offers manufacturing solutions for automotive applications, including LiDAR and other sensing technologies.
  • Medical Devices: Manufactures components and modules for medical devices, such as diagnostic equipment and surgical tools.

leadership logo Leadership and Structure

Seamus Grady is the Chief Executive Officer. The company has a standard corporate structure with a board of directors and various executive management positions overseeing different functional areas.

Market Dynamics

industry overview logo Industry Overview

The optical communications and precision manufacturing industry is driven by increasing bandwidth demands, the growth of data centers, and advancements in laser technology and medical device technology. The industry is experiencing growth in areas like 5G, cloud computing, and advanced manufacturing techniques.

Positioning

Fabrinet is positioned as a high-precision manufacturing partner for OEMs in various industries. Their competitive advantage lies in their ability to handle complex manufacturing processes and their expertise in optical and electro-mechanical technologies.

Fabrinet provides optical packaging and precision optical, electro-mechanical, and electronic manufacturing services in North America, the Asia-Pacific, and Europe. The company offers a range of advanced optical and electro-mechanical capabilities in the manufacturing process, including process design and engineering, supply chain management, manufacturing, printed circuit board assembly, advanced packaging, integration, final assembly, and testing. Its products include switching products, including reconfigurable optical add-drop multiplexers, optical amplifiers, modulators, and other optical components and modules that enable network managers to route voice, video, and data communications traffic through fiber optic cables at various wavelengths, speeds, and over various distances. The company's products also comprise transceivers, tunable lasers, and transponders; and active optical cables, which provide high-speed interconnect capabilities for data centers and computing clusters, as well as Infiniband, Ethernet, fiber channel, and optical backplane connectivity. In addition, it provides solid state, diode-pumped, gas, and fiber lasers used in semiconductor processing, biotechnology and medical device, metrology, and material processing industries; and differential pressure, micro-gyro, fuel, and other sensors used in automobiles, as well as non-contact temperature measurement sensors for the medical industry. Further, the company designs and fabricates application-specific crystals, lenses, prisms, mirrors, laser components, and substrates; and other custom and standard borosilicate, clear fused quartz, and synthetic fused silica glass products. It serves original equipment manufacturers of optical communication components, modules and sub-systems, industrial lasers, automotive components, medical devices, and sensors. The company was incorporated in 1999 and is based in George Town, the Cayman Islands.
